Four exclusive camps and the private Granite Suites are secluded amongst towering trees on the banks of the Sand River.

Founders Camp

Location

It is situated on the Sand River at the very heart of the Sabi Sands Game Reserve. This reserve in turn forms part of the Greater Limpopo Transfrontier Park, a vast and growing area, currently covering 6 million acres and incorporating the famous Kruger National Park. This rich wild wonderland assures exceptional game drives and a true wilderness experience.

Accommodation and facilities

Founders Camp honours past guests and staff who have contributed to building Londolozi and assisting in distilling all the ecotourism learning of the past 30 years into a singular state.

Enchanting and intimate, Founder's Camp is ideally situated to provide an insider's view on the secrets of river life. Five idyllic sanctuaries repose in the shade of ancient Ebony and Matumi trees along the banks of the Sand River.

This is safari in the classic style, replete with classic black and cream ticking fabric and original mahogany beds. Deep leather couches, military chests, compass safari lamps and a riverside lounge sala, create a mood of easy luxury and laid back welcome for discerning families and travellers.

Pioneer Camp

Location

It is situated on the Sand River at the very heart of the Sabi Sands Game Reserve. This reserve in turn forms part of the Greater Limpopo Transfrontier Park, a vast and growing area, currently covering 6 million acres and incorporating the famous Kruger National Park. This rich wild wonderland assures exceptional game drives and a true wilderness experience.

Accommodation and facilities

Pioneer Camp is steeped in the early history of Londolozi. It was here that over eighty years ago the Varty ancestors arrived after three days of hard travel by rail, wagon and on foot, and pitched their tents in the falling light.

They awoke in an illuminated landscape of breathtaking beauty. Unique, peaceful and remote, this wild untrammelled wilderness is still the defining experience at Pioneer Camp.

A 500-year old Riverine forest throws dappled light on the six private sanctuaries and provides a dramatic backdrop for the camp's celebration of the past.

The interior conjures old English indulgence with an African twist. The colonial influences are evident in the elegant cream interiors, silver teapots at high tea and Portmeirion crockery.

Great sanctuaries are themed with historic memorabilia, telling a story of a bygone era and furnishing an environment of leisurely indulgence.

A campfire has burned here for over 80 years making Varty Camp the symbolic heart and soul of Londolozi.

The decor echoes tones of the Varty's own home and their continuing love affair with the earth. During the building and refurbishment process great care was taken with every tree and all changes were carefully assessed to ensure a light touch - reflecting the family's passion for sustainability.

All room sanctuaries have private swimming pools framed by timber decks, overlooking the riverbank. The living spaces are raised off the ground and shaded under a cathedral of trees.

The camp has a pleasantly down-to-earth quality and the emphasis on family heritage means that children always have a place at Varty Camp.

This is also the location of the Life Wellness Centre, Living boutique and Jon Varty Cinematography Centre; all intended to widen the guest experience.
